Red Flash Swimmer Dunn Named NEC Swimmer-of-the-Week
LORETTO, Pa. (October 24, 2008) - Saint Francis swimmer Jessica Dunn (Bristow, Va./Seton School) has been named the Northeast Conference Swimmer-of-the-Week for the week of October 21, as announced by the league on Tuesday. Dunn, a freshman, garnered the honor after taking first place in both of her events in the Red Flash’s win at Cleveland State on Oct. 18.
In only her first collegiate meet, Dunn placed first in the 200 yard individual medley with a time of 2:14.78. She also touched first in the 100 yard backstroke, finishing in 1:01.16.
The Red Flash beat Cleveland State on Saturday by a score of 106-99 in their first meet of the season. The team, which finished second at the NEC championships last year, has recently been picked to finish second again in the NEC Preseason Poll that is voted on by the head coaches. Defending champion Central Connecticut State has been picked to finish first again.
The team will travel to Lewisburg for a meet with both the Bucknell Bison and the Duquesne Dukes on November 1.
